Can I withdraw money won with the free chip?
Yes, you can withdraw winnings from the free chip, but there are conditions. The winnings are subject to a wagering requirement, which means you must bet the amount a certain number of times before you can withdraw it. For example, if the offer has a 20x wagering requirement, and you receive a $10 free chip, you need to place bets totaling $200 before the winnings become eligible for withdrawal. Always check the specific terms linked to the offer, as requirements can vary. Withdrawals are processed through the same method used for deposits.
Are there any games I can play with the free chip?
The free chip can be used on most slot games available at Big Candy Casino. Popular titles like Fruit Frenzy, Lucky Leprechaun, and Wild Wonders are typically included. However, some games may not count toward the wagering requirement, or they might contribute only partially. For example, slots usually count 100%, while table games or live dealer games might count at a lower rate or not at all. Check the game rules section of the promotion to see which games are eligible and how much they contribute toward meeting the wagering conditions.
